Meet Upside:

We created Upside to transform brick-and-mortar commerce. Our technology uses the sophistication of online retail-profit measurement, attribution, and incrementality-to provide users with more value on their everyday purchases and brick-and-mortar businesses with new, profitable customers. We've helped millions of users earn 2 to 3 times more cashback than any other product, and hundreds of thousands of brick-and-mortar businesses earn measurable profit. Billions of dollars in commerce run through the Upside platform every year, and that value goes directly back to our retailer partners, the consumers they serve, and important sustainability initiatives.

The Impact You'll Make:

Reporting to the Consumer Strategy & Operations Principal, this role serves as the central coordination hub for the consumer business, driving operational excellence and cohesion across the Consumer Marketing organization and its partners. The position ensures that strategic priorities are translated into actionable plans, fosters clear collaboration across teams, and supports the organization's ability to deliver results and scale in a fast-moving environment.

  • Own end-to-end project planning for cross-functional initiatives, translating topline objectives into integrated roadmaps, sequencing work across teams, and ensuring execution reflects business needs, not just those of individual projects.
  • Anticipate and manage interdependencies, risks, and tradeoffs across a complex initiative portfolio, proactively surfacing implications, facilitating decisions, and re-balancing plans as circumstances and timelines evolve.
  • Build and maintain operating systems and rhythms (e.g. internal communications, team onsites, team project management, goal-setting, quarterly planning, executive readouts) that create accountability and alignment for the Consumer Marketing organization and partner teams.
  • Partner closely with teammates to evolve the consumer operating model, shaping processes, governance, tooling, and documentation that improve prioritization, execution, and scalability as the business grows.
  • Take first pen on project plans and new organizational approaches, identifying the gaps between what the team has and what the team needs to up-level initiatives both large and small.

Location:

This hybrid role is required to work at our DC or NYC office. In-office attendance is required on Monday, Tuesday, and Thursday and may increase based on project-based needs and changes to Upside's in-office policy over time.

Compensation:

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$112,000 - $135,000 + equity + benefits. The final starting pay will be determined based on job-related skills, experience, qualifications, work location, and market conditions.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range during the hiring process.
